A New England staple of creamy clam chowder with clams, potatoes and salt pork. It is closely tied to coastal Massachusetts cooking.
Boston baked beans are slow-cooked with molasses and salt pork. They reflect the region’s colonial-era cooking and gave Boston its old nickname.
A classic sandwich of roast beef on an onion roll, usually topped with barbecue sauce, mayo and cheese. It is a beloved Greater Boston takeaway order.

Cambridge is pricey for US city breaks, with high hotel rates and restaurant prices; public transport is limited, so taxis or rideshares can add to costs.
Tip 18-20% in restaurants, more for excellent service. Taxis usually get 10-15%. In cafés, round up or add $1-2 for barista service.
